About Coppabella Village

Coppabella is described internally as Civeo’s largest village facility, supported by a broad on-site team including Facilities, Housekeeping, Administration, Guest Services, Health & Lifestyle and Food & Beverage servicing up to 3200 guests at any one time.

About Us

Civeo Australia (a division of Civeo Corporation) provides workforce accommodation services across Australia with a national footprint of approximately 10,000 rooms across twelve villages in QLD, NSW and WA, plus additional client-owned operations in remote regions.
